Recorded and released in The Netherlands by Gerry Teekens for his Criss Cross label in 1985, ‘Chet’s Choice’ marked one of the best studio albums from Chet Baker’s final years. He would die in The Netherlands, after falling from the window of his hotel room in Amsterdam on May 13, 1988. ‘Chet’s Choice’ presents Baker, beautifully captured in Stereo, singing and playing the trumpet in an intimate trio format with guitarist Philip Catherine (born in England but raised in Belgium, Chet frequently worked with him from 1983 to 1988) and Belgian bassist Jean-Louis Rassinfosse on most of the tracks (three tunes were taped during a second session with Dutch bassist Hein van de Geijn). This expanded edition presents the full seven tunes from the original album plus three songs that only previously appeared on the CD edition of ‘Chet’s Choice’ (‘My Foolish Heart’, ‘Blues in the Closet’ and ‘Stella by Starlight’), as well as five amazing never before heard alternate takes, which add nearly forty minutes of unreleased music to Chet Baker’s superb catalogue.
